Teacher Terror is a podcast where your two favorite elementary school teachers rate and review horror movies. Each episode centers around a themed “assignment,†and Abby and Marsha bring their favorite scary movies to the table to discuss.

Join us for this special episode where we chat with William R. Perry about his time as a stunt man in movies such as Home Alone 2, Return of the Living Dead II, A Nightmare on Elm Street 3, and his work as an actor in Predator 2. More recently, Bill has authored a horror novelette entitled By His Hand and is currently working on a sequel! Bill also discusses his time as a SpEd teacher in California, and he brings the perfect combination of teacher and terror to this special episode of Teacher Terror!
